An IELTS (International English Language Testing Score) overall score of 7.0 is required, with a minimum of 6.5 in writing and 7.0 in the other three components. If applicants not born in the UK (or an English majority speaking country), have been in the country for a minimum of three years and have completed an HNC, Access Course (or above) in the UK, then they do not need to undertake IELTS or the Occupational English language test in advance of starting the course. What it means to be a "student nurse" has changed a great deal over the lifetime of the NHS, with the expectations, status and rights of student nurses changing between 1948 and the present day. The first general training school for nurses had been founded at St Thomas hospital by Florence Nightingale in 1860 and it was largely her ideology of service and discipline that dominated nurse education into the 20th Century.
